Does anyone know of a way to merge 2 dynamic PDF forms into 1 PDF with combined answers. I have created a dynamic form and distributed the form to my users. Each user will be required to fill out a specific section of the form and send it back to me. When I receive the seperate distributed PDF forms that are filled out and combine them into the response PDF they remain individual documents. Is there any way to combine the answers I receive on each form into a single PDF form? I see I can export everything into Excel, but I would like to just combine all filled in fields from all the distributed dynamic forms into 1 PDF. Any ideas would be appreciated :)

Hi,

dynamic forms can't be merged.
But you can flatten them by printing via pdf printer.
Those files you than can merge with Acrobat to a single file.
